git项目分支develop
-
在使用git管理项目时,分支是一种非常重要的概念。分支可以让我们在开发过程中并行进行不同的任务,而不会互相干扰。其中一个常见的分支命名就是develop分支。
首先,develop分支通常被用来作为项目的主线开发分支。它可以被认为是一个稳定的版本,用于集成团队成员的代码,并进行测试和代码审查。当一个特性的开发完成并且被合并到develop分支后,它就可以被认为是一次小的迭代或者功能的增量。
其次,develop分支的创建通常是基于主分支(一般是master分支)的最新代码。通过从主分支拉取最新的代码,我们可以确保develop分支是基于最新的项目版本,减少代码冲突的可能性。同时,develop分支还可以用来解决和修复项目中的问题和bug。
在团队协作中,每个开发人员通常都有自己的个人分支来开发和测试新功能。当某个功能开发完毕并且通过了测试和审查后,开发人员会将该功能的分支合并到develop分支,确保代码的可靠性和稳定性。
需要注意的是,develop分支不应该直接部署到生产环境中,而是通过发布分支或者其他机制来进行部署。因为develop分支可能包含尚未完成或者未经充分测试的功能,直接部署可能会引入潜在的风险和问题。
总结起来,develop分支在git项目中扮演着重要的角色,它是项目的主线开发分支,用于集成开发人员的代码和进行测试和审查。通过合并功能分支到develop分支,我们能够逐步完善和增强项目的功能。然后通过其他机制将develop分支中的代码部署到生产环境中,确保项目的稳定性和可靠性。
2年前 -
1. 为什么要在Git项目中使用develop分支?
在Git项目中,使用develop分支是一种常见的工作流程。它的目的是将开发的功能隔离开来,从而保护主干分支(通常是master分支)的稳定性。develop分支可以被视为一个集成分支,团队成员可以在该分支上并行开发新功能,并在开发完成后合并到主干分支上。
2. develop分支的创建和管理
要创建develop分支,可以使用Git命令行或者Git图形界面工具。通常情况下,可以通过以下步骤创建和管理develop分支:
– 在主干分支(如master)上创建一个新的分支,命名为develop。
– 开发团队成员可以基于develop分支创建自己的个人分支,并在个人分支上进行开发工作。
– 当个人分支上的开发工作完成时,可以将代码合并到develop分支上,确保测试和集成。
– develop分支上的开发工作完成后,可以将其合并到主干分支(通常是master),并发布新的版本。3. develop分支的优点
使用develop分支有以下几个优点:
– 保护主干分支的稳定性:主干分支通常用于发布稳定版本,使用develop分支进行开发避免了对主干分支的直接修改,从而提高了代码的稳定性。
– 促进并行开发:团队成员可以在develop分支上并行开发不同的功能,提高开发效率。
– 方便代码审核:develop分支中的代码变更可以方便地进行审核和测试,确保质量。
– 方便追踪和管理功能:develop分支上的每个变更都可以与特定的功能或任务关联起来,使功能和任务的追踪和管理更加方便。
– 容易与其他仓库进行集成:开源项目通常使用develop分支作为向其他仓库(如Fork仓库)提供贡献的基础。4. develop分支的注意事项
在使用develop分支时,需要注意一些事项:
– develop分支应该是稳定和可测试的。避免将未经验证的功能合并到develop分支上,以减少后续的冲突和问题。
– 遵循良好的分支管理策略,例如删除已经合并到主干分支的个人分支,定期进行分支合并和删除等。
– 开发团队成员需要遵循一致的分支命名和合并规则,以避免混乱和错误。
– 使用合适的工具和流程来支持代码审查、自动化测试和持续集成。
– 多人协作时需要沟通和协调好开发计划、分支合并和版本发布事宜。5. develop分支与其他分支的关系
develop分支通常是一个集成分支,与其他分支(如个人开发分支、功能分支等)存在关系。当一个功能在个人分支上开发完成并通过测试时,将其合并到develop分支上。随后,develop分支的更新可以与其他分支同步或者合并到主干分支上进行版本发布。这样的分支关系可以通过Git的分支合并和切换命令来实现。
2年前 -
Git是一种分布式版本控制系统,它允许多个开发者在同一项目上并行工作,并且能够简化代码的合并和管理。Git拥有一个强大的分支系统,可以让开发者在一个项目中同时进行多个并行的开发工作。在Git中,一个分支就是一个相对独立的代码库,开发者可以在不同的分支上进行不同的工作。
本文将详细介绍如何创建并管理一个名为develop的分支。
## 1. 创建develop分支
在Git中,可以使用以下命令来创建一个新分支:
“`
git branch develop
“`
这将创建一个名为develop的分支,但当前分支不会自动切换到该分支上。## 2. 切换到develop分支
使用以下命令可以切换到develop分支:
“`
git checkout develop
“`
这将切换当前分支为develop分支,开发者可以在该分支上进行工作。## 3. 在develop分支进行开发工作
切换到develop分支后,可以进行正常的开发工作,包括添加、删除、修改文件以及提交代码等。## 4. 查看分支状态
可以使用以下命令来查看当前分支以及所有分支的状态:
“`
git branch
“`
分支前面带有*的表示当前所在的分支。## 5. 合并develop分支到主分支
当在develop分支上的开发工作完成后,我们可以将develop分支合并到主分支(通常是master分支)中。
首先,切换到主分支:
“`
git checkout master
“`
然后,使用以下命令进行合并:
“`
git merge develop
“`
这将把develop分支上的代码合并到master分支,并生成一个新的提交。## 6. 删除develop分支
在开发完成并合并到主分支后,可以删除develop分支,以避免分支过多造成管理混乱。使用以下命令删除develop分支:
“`
git branch -d develop
“`
如果develop分支包含未合并的更改,Git将会报错。在这种情况下,可以使用强制删除的方式来删除分支:
“`
git branch -D develop
“`总结:
通过创建develop分支,开发者可以在该分支上进行并行的开发工作。当开发工作完成后,可以将develop分支合并回主分支,并删除develop分支。这样可以提高团队协作的效率,同时保持代码的整洁和可维护性。2年前